Output 49153ba91a853d3792b4a7017f622a12a648bd116760a6fb169c22e8f8a9b107:19

value
853948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ba65da6202261c304a179641bbb2fe198ed1ba3d OP_EQUAL
address
3Jgbd6gSN7QRTMgNSTcBVrb6Cv5it8HCqr
transaction
49153ba91a853d3792b4a7017f622a12a648bd116760a6fb169c22e8f8a9b107
confirmations
203781
spent
true